본문으로 건너뛰기

event_scheduler 설정이 가능한가요?

💡 요약 정리

  • 리눅스 웹호스팅에서는 MySQL/MariaDB의 event_scheduler 설정이 불가합니다.
  • 웹호스팅(공유호스팅)은 서버 자원을 다수의 사용자가 공유하는 환경이므로, 서버 안정성을 위해 event_scheduler 설정을 지원하지 않습니다.

1. event_scheduler란?

MySQL/MariaDB의 event_scheduler는 지정한 시간이나 주기에 따라 SQL 이벤트를 자동으로 실행하는 기능입니다.

event_scheduler=ON으로 설정한 후 CREATE EVENT 구문을 통해 예약된 작업을 등록하고 자동 실행할 수 있습니다.


2. 웹호스팅에서 지원이 불가한 이유

웹호스팅(공유호스팅)은 하나의 서버를 다수의 사용자가 공유하는 환경입니다.

event_scheduler는 서버의 MySQL 전역 설정에 해당하며, 활성화 시 서버 자원(CPU, 메모리)을 추가로 점유하게 되어 다른 사용자에게 영향을 줄 수 있으므로 지원하지 않습니다.


💡 팁

event_scheduler 설정이 필수적이라면, event_scheduler=ON 설정이 가능한 리눅스 단독웹호스팅으로의 상품 변경을 권장합니다.

단독웹호스팅에서는 1:1 문의게시판을 통해 설정 요청이 가능합니다.